    Sticker stuck on snake (emergency need help asap)
    My snake just removed the humidity gauge and now it's stuck on his skin, I can't get it off and it seems like he is very badly hurt I really need help. The vet isn't picking up and I'm just very worried I really dont know what to do HELP PLEASE

    Try warm water and a soft wet wash cloth. Rub gently after you wet it until the adhesive breaks up.

    Cooking oil works to remove adhesives....you need some kind of organic solvent that isn't harsh on animals...rubbing alcohol would work but would chill them down too much I think...

    Glad to help...I saw that on an old reality show where the kid's snake got stuck to a glueboard for rats, and also saw it used on a canary at the petshop in town.


    Hope your guy is OK...I'd try for a digital thermometer/hygrometer combo in the future. They don't have adhesive
